A casino is an establishment where people can participate in a variety of games of chance and enjoy other recreational activities. The etymology of the word casino is traced back to Italy, where it once denoted something as simple as a villa or a summerhouse or even a social club.

First, you need to understand that a casino isn’t just a place where you can gamble; it is also a business. They make money through the games they offer and from the odds that they set for their customers. They are also responsible for ensuring that their clients are safe while they are at the casino.

They have a variety of security measures in place to keep their patrons and staff safe from crime and other dangers. These include a physical security force, specialized surveillance and closed circuit television systems. They also have security personnel on hand to respond to calls for assistance and reports of suspicious or definite criminal activity.

In the United States, there are over 1,000 casinos. This number is growing as more states try to legalize the practice of gambling.

Most of these casinos have thousands of slot machines and other electronic gaming devices to provide a variety of options for players. They also have tables where players can play roulette, blackjack, poker and other table games.

These games typically have a house edge, which is the percentage advantage that the casino holds over the player. This advantage is determined by mathematically calculated odds. It is important to note that the house edge can change depending on a game’s rules and number of players.

In addition to these things, some casinos offer special incentives for gamblers. These incentives can be in the form of complimentary items or services. These include hotel rooms, dinners and tickets to various events.

Some casinos even offer free transportation to and from the casino if you have a large amount of money. These are known as comps and are usually offered to players who spend a lot of time at the casino or on the slot machines.
